Output 3626fb61156d3b661dfb6c73cfe6f47e74680c6d5060116050132fb81626e6ac:3

value
25900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e3f5ed750bd902cfe14d33d49588b14231a4dcd OP_EQUAL
address
35uYvRdzE1UCmhEq2pQYibbEH67xfGd4fk
transaction
3626fb61156d3b661dfb6c73cfe6f47e74680c6d5060116050132fb81626e6ac
spent
true